The extract-strings script scans all template and component files for translation markers and writes them to the locale manifest. It runs nightly, but you can trigger it manually before a release. Common pitfalls: dynamically constructed keys are not detected, and comments inside markers break the parser. Always review the diff before committing the regenerated manifest. If the script produces unexpected output or you need scanner changes, contact the localization tooling owner below.

billing contact of kajof-kahap = quenix@tolvaqworks.internal

To the release manager: I'm passing ownership of the Pellwick deep-link router to Sorrel before the 4.2 cut. The intent-matching table now lives in the Farrowgate config service; stale entries were purged last sprint. Watch the fallback route — it silently swallows malformed slugs, which inflated our drop-off metrics in March. The staging resolver needs its keystore unlocked before each regression pass, and that keystore accepts only one credential. For the signing vault, the recovery phrase is noted directly below.

recovery phrase for tafog-fafog: novix-novdor-fraath-brieth-olieth-oliix-rusix-wenion-julax-druox

If plugin users report sluggish suggestions, the Quickmere autocomplete index is usually behind on segment merges. Check the merge backlog gauge first; anything above a few hundred segments means the indexer is starved. Do not trigger a full rebuild during peak hours — it blocks the suggestion API for all plugins. Instead, raise the merge thread allowance temporarily and let it drain. Plugin authors replicating this locally should match the production tuning. The index runs with the following values.

config for kafof-bawef:
holath:
  log_level: debug
  metrics_host: metrics.holath.qorvelsys.internal
  pin: 2191
  pool_size: 32